MIAMI – March 1, 2010 – Holland & Knight is pleased to announce that it has been named among the world's leading law firms earning notable rankings in several practice areas in the 2010 Chambers Global guide – The World's Leading Lawyers for Business.

Globally, the firm ranked in Bands 3 and 4 in the following practice areas respectively:

      • Shipping
      • Asset Finance

Several of the firm's lawyers ranked in the guide's Global and Countries sections:

Global

      • Asset Finance – John F. Pritchard (New York), Band 2 and Nancy L. Hengen (New York), Band 3
      • Shipping – Nancy L. Hengen, Band 3

Mexico

      • Corporate M&A – Eduardo Gallástequi Armella (Mexico City), Band 3

USA

      • Investment Funds: Hedge Funds – Scott R. MacLeod (Orlando), Band 3
      • Outsourcing – Richard Raysman (New York), Band 3

The Chambers Global guide is designed to reflect market opinion through a year's worth of surveys of clients and lawyers world-wide. It is one of a series of Chambers and Partners independent, objective and research-based guides to the legal profession. The qualities on which rankings are assessed include technical legal ability, professional conduct, client service, commercial astuteness, diligence, commitment and other qualities most valued by clients.
